California’s Top Opportunities by Specialty

AMN Healthcare receives new travel nurse jobs in California each day from hospitals and healthcare facilities. If you are looking for a specific California travel nurse job, please see below for in-demand nursing specialties needed throughout the state:

Specialty Average Salary Cities with highest paying jobs
Surgical $111.10 /hour*
First Assist $89.87 /hour* Mountain View, Joshua Tree and Palm Springs
Pre/Post Operative $84.11 /hour* Redwood City
Pediatric Intensive Care Unit $83.54 /hour* Palo Alto
Cath Lab $74.68 /hour* Mountain View, Merced and Indio
Operating Room $70.29 /hour* Redwood City, Mountain View and San Rafael
Case Manager $69.85 /hour* Loma Linda, Los Angeles and Lakewood
Labor & Delivery $68.89 /hour* Modesto, Clovis and Fountain Valley

*Estimate of hourly payments is intended for informational purposes and includes hourly wages, as well as reimbursements for meal & incidental expenses and housing expenses incurred on behalf of the Company. Please speak with your Recruiter for additional details.

Why Consider a Travel Nurse Job in California?

California beckons travel nurses with its vibrant wildlife, encompassing magnificent marine life, inland birds, waterfowl, and enchanting forest creatures. The state's major metropolises, such as Los Angeles, San Francisco, and San Diego, serve as international cultural hotspots, offering unique and cosmopolitan experiences. Moreover, California's larger cities like San Jose, Oakland, and Santa Ana provide excellent healthcare prospects within cutting-edge facilities, making it an ideal destination for healthcare professionals on the move.
